Output 588d0cba7cba098e85672d9518bcf2f1dd284291e41b35b156035641c5203294:25

value
434629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d42720eefd6764cec24387eca39b087daa48c1 OP_EQUAL
address
32DqT98sDMhLwgZdoHJdPAFecTUzW35eTb
transaction
588d0cba7cba098e85672d9518bcf2f1dd284291e41b35b156035641c5203294
spent
true